Sr Program Director

Hill International is seeking a Sr Program Director in Utah. Focus on leadership and management of mega-projects and major programs for Hill's clients. These projects and programs are aligned to the strategic markets and underlying business objectives of the firm. Lead transformative programs that shape Utah's infrastructure landscape, working with key stakeholders like UDOT, UTA, and DCFM to deliver high-profile, community-focused transportation and facilities projects. Lead the adoption of cutting-edge tools, technologies, and best practices to enhance project delivery, efficiency, and client satisfaction in Utah's transportation and facilities markets. Leverage your network to strengthen relationships with contractors, A / E firms, and key decision-makers, positioning Hill as the go-to partner for major projects. Guide and inspire project teams, fostering a culture of excellence and collaboration while recruiting top-tier professionals to support Hill's growth in Utah. Serves as the Hill central point of contact, functional leader, and senior subject matter expert in program management. Identify business, client, and project opportunities. Establish positive client and partner relationships through successful networking and presentations. Utilize market research, competitor analysis, professional conferences, and other means to identify potential new markets and ways to grow in current markets. Assist in the development and implementation of effective teaming strategies. Assess staffing abilities and identify strategic hires necessary to achieve company goals. Provide project management and construction management services. Minimum 15 years construction management experience in heavy civil, highway, rail, commercial construction projects, including design-build (DB), progressive-design-build (PDB), contract manager / general contractor (CM / GC) and P3 concessionaire. Bachelor's degree in the field of engineering, architecture, or construction management preferred. Familiarity and strong relationships with local market, contractors, A / E firms and clients. Excellent technical writing, verbal communication, and presentation skills. Location : Salt Lake City, UT USA.

Market / local experience : UDOT, UTA, DCFM.
